Diwali symbolizes the triumph of light above darkness and the need for people to acknowledge and reduce the negativity inside themselves for the duration of their lifetimes.

The dates on the Competition are determined by the Hindu lunar calendar, commonly slipping in late Oct or early November.

Dhanteras commences from the Diwali celebrations Using the lights of Diya or Panati lamp rows, house cleaning and ground rangoli Dhanteras, derived from Dhan indicating prosperity and teras this means thirteenth, marks the thirteenth working day on the dim fortnight of Ashwin or Kartik and the beginning of Diwali for most areas of India.[one hundred fifteen] On today, many Hindus clear their homes and organization premises. They set up diyas, smaller earthen oil-loaded lamps which they light-weight up for the next 5 times, close to Lakshmi and Ganesha iconography.[115][112] Ladies and children adorn doorways within homes and places of work with rangolis, colourful models comprised of rice flour, flower petals, coloured rice or coloured sand,[26] though the boys and Adult men beautify the roofs and partitions of household houses, marketplaces, and temples and string up lights and lanterns.

Persons celebrate Diwali by lights up their residences and streets with diyas and candles, dressing up in new apparel, exchanging presents, and indulging in delicious classic diwali meals.

Through Diwali, men and women also make patterns called rangoli from colourful supplies like powders and pastes.
